Bexley Report written by Susan Lee (She/her)
In a couple of weeks we are helping the Community Hospice collect donations alongside Bexley Rotary Club's much loved Santa Sleigh. Our task this evening was delivering leaflets to houses along the route so they knew when Santa will be visiting their street.
It was an earlier-than-usual start as we were heading for our Xmas meal straight after the task.
We set off briskly, admiring the Christmas lights and decorations as we weaved our way in and out of driveways. On route we arrived at the Xmas House ablaze with lights and it's own Santa sleigh 🛷 🎅🏻 on the roof! What a spectacle!
After photos we carried on with the leaflets, racing around the roads to cover as much ground as possible. Unfortunately Manish had an encounter with an excited pup 🐶 and needed to get some medical advice. We wish him well and hope to see him soon.
Leaflets delivered, it was on to our Xmas social where there was lots of merriment and celebrations. We have had an excellent year at GoodGym Bexley and as we reflected over the achievements we all raised our glasses 🍷. Greenwich Report written by Rachel Henry
What a glorious morning we had at Mycenae Gardens yesterday! After joining a post Junior Parkrun coffee with those double deeding heroes amongst us, we had a warm up and quick discussion on what we're looking forward to this winter. Answers ranged from mulled wine to winter being over!
Twelve runners set off on the 3km run, including Roshan who completed his first ever good deed with us - great to have you along Roshan! On arrival, after a briefing from the amazing Fiona we got straight to work.
The task for the day was pruning bushes and low-hanging branches, then dragging the cuttings over to the dead hedge. Everyone pitched in, weaving branches into the hedge to reinforce it and make it sturdy. Seamless teamwork and the hour flew by faster than we expected.
With the hard work done and a few thorny fingers to prove it, we rounded things off with the best reward: coffee and cake. And just when we thought the morning couldn’t get any better, Ceci choreographed some dances to make it an extra memorable session (check Instagram for those!).

Greenwich Report written by Cecilia D🍀 (She/her)
We were blessed with yet another morning of sunshine at Hornfair Junior parkrun, and it truly made all the difference. The bright weather brought an extra spark of energy as we supported the event and cheered on the young runners through a smooth and cheerful session.
A big congratulations goes to the two young runners who received their milestone wristband's. One of them reached an astounding 200 runs, an achievement that deserves every bit of celebration. The post-event cakes shared among volunteers and families made the milestone even sweeter.
